These diseases can be fatal, so it is important to vaccinate your animals to protect them.

Vaccinations work by introducing a weakened or killed form of the virus into the animal's body. This allows the animal's immune system to develop antibodies against the disease without actually getting sick. If the animal is then exposed to the live virus, their immune system will be able to recognize it and fight it off.

Maintain a clean and healthy environment

Maintaining a clean and healthy environment for animals is an essential aspect of "how to check animals in owo" as it plays a crucial role in preventing the spread of diseases, ensuring the well-being of the animals, and promoting their overall health.

  • Sanitation and hygiene

    Proper sanitation and hygiene practices are fundamental to maintaining a clean and healthy environment for animals. Regular cleaning and disinfection of animal enclosures, equipment, and utensils help prevent the buildup of pathogens and reduce the risk of disease transmission. Good hygiene practices, such as handwashing and proper waste disposal, also contribute to a clean and healthy environment.

  • Ventilation and air quality

    Adequate ventilation is essential to maintain good air quality in animal enclosures. Proper ventilation helps remove harmful gases, dust, and moisture, creating a healthier environment for the animals. It also helps prevent the spread of airborne diseases and respiratory problems.

  • Nutrition and water

    Providing animals with a balanced diet and clean, fresh water is crucial for their health and well-being. A nutritious diet supports the immune system and helps animals resist diseases. Access to clean water is essential for hydration, waste elimination, and overall body function.

  • Pest control

    Effective pest control measures are necessary to prevent the introduction and spread of pests, such as rodents and insects, which can carry diseases and pose a health risk to animals. Regular monitoring, pest-proofing of enclosures, and proper waste management are important aspects of pest control.
